Default Blox TB Idle Problem

ls/vtec with a b18c1 head. blox tb with stock IM port matched. i had to replace the head due to the other b18c1 head blowing. so once i finally got around to fixing this thing, we started it up and i was having some alignment issues with the throttle cable end matching up with one of the 4 holes on the blox TB.

the throttle cable didnt fit into any of the existing 4 holes so i had to make a new hole that was close to the cable end. it looks like blox provided other holes for you to use if need be, just had to drimmel a slot for the actual cable part, the circular piece went right in.

anyways i got the throttle cable bracket to match up with the bottom of the IM but i only had one bolt. that shouldnt matter since it is in position and tight.

so anyways, the TB doesnt "look" to be opened at all but i dont know that for sure. so when i fire up the car, it sits at 1500rpm roughly, but when i rev it up, it drops back down to the normal 700rpm but then shoots right back up to 1500rpm.

could i have a faulty IACV? i have an extra one lying around from the old head but im not sure whats goin on, i also have a stock TB but it doesnt have the actually pulley part so i know it wont work.

any help is appreciated.
